2002 Audi A6 vs. 2002 Nissan Altima

To start off, both 2002 Audi A6 and 2002 Nissan Altima were released in the same year (2002). Therefore the support and the availability on parts for both vehicles should be relatively similar. At 4,172 cc (8 cylinders), 2002 Audi A6 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2002 Audi A6 (296 HP @ 6200 RPM) has 49 more horse power than 2002 Nissan Altima. (247 HP @ 5800 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2002 Audi A6 should accelerate faster than 2002 Nissan Altima.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2002 Audi A6 weights approximately 425 kg more than 2002 Nissan Altima.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Because 2002 Audi A6 is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2002 Nissan Altima.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2002 Audi A6 will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2002 Audi A6 (400 Nm @ 3000 RPM) has 62 more torque (in Nm) than 2002 Nissan Altima. (338 Nm @ 4400 RPM). This means 2002 Audi A6 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2002 Nissan Altima.
